The Importance Of Testing In Electrical Installation

Electrical installations are a crucial component of any building, providing power to devices and systems that are essential for daily operations. Proper testing of electrical installations is necessary to ensure the safety and functionality of the electrical system. testing in electrical installation involves a series of checks and measurements to verify that all components are installed correctly and are working as intended.

One of the main reasons why testing in electrical installation is so important is safety. Faulty electrical installations can lead to electrical shocks, fires, and other dangerous situations. By conducting thorough testing of the electrical system, potential hazards can be identified and rectified before they cause harm. This helps to protect both the individuals using the building and the property itself.

There are several types of tests that are commonly performed during the installation of electrical systems. One of the most basic tests is a continuity test, which checks that there is a complete path for electricity to flow through the system. This test is essential for ensuring that all components are properly connected and that there are no breaks in the circuit.

Another important test is the insulation resistance test, which checks the insulation of the electrical system to ensure that there are no leaks or faults that could cause a short circuit. This test is particularly important in areas where moisture is present, as water can easily compromise the insulation of electrical components.

Voltage testing is also crucial in electrical installations, as it helps to verify that the system is providing the correct voltage to devices and equipment. Incorrect voltage levels can cause damage to sensitive electronics and can significantly impact the performance of electrical systems.

In addition to these tests, polarity checks, earth fault loop impedance tests, and RCD testing are also commonly performed during the installation of electrical systems. Each of these tests serves a specific purpose in ensuring the safety and functionality of the electrical system.

testing in electrical installation is not only important during the initial installation process but should also be conducted periodically to ensure that the system remains in good working order. Regular testing can help to identify any issues that may have developed over time and can prevent more serious problems from occurring in the future.

It is also important to note that testing in electrical installation should only be carried out by qualified professionals who have the necessary training and expertise to perform the tests safely and accurately. Attempting to test electrical installations without the proper knowledge and equipment can be extremely dangerous and can result in serious injury or damage to the system.
